A few days back, I installed/repaired the X86 and X64 runtimes, https://learn.microsoft.com/en-us/cpp/windows/latest-supported-vc-redist?view=msvc-170 and also installed the legacy DirectX runtime, some older games require it, https://www.microsoft.com/en-ca/download/details.aspx?id=35
This solved my issue while running the regular version of SteamVR, 2.7.4, but a dev asked if I would try the updated beta. So I switched to that, and currently SteamVR is still working fine.
step 1:Go to steam vr app in your steam library and find that good ole settings button and give it the good click on properties
Step 2:Find the installed files tab in the menu that popped up and click the button that says browse
Step 3:See all those files? select them all and delete them go find your recycling bin and delete those permanently
Step 4: Go back to your steam vr app in your library and uninstall it
Step 5:Reinstall and you should have a fresh unbuggy steam vr fun time
